Walk with Our Lady Fall Festival
Our Lady of Mount Carmel Catholic Church, 701 Fillmore Street NE, will put on their seventy-eighth annual Fall Festival on Sunday, Sept. 25, 10 a.m.-4 p.m. The Festival kicks off with the Liturgy at 10 a.m. followed by a Marian Procession at 11:15 a.m. Festivities include traditional spaghetti and meatball dinner, silent auction, root beer garden, ice cream sunday bar, kid’s games, kid’s and teen bike raffle, $500 grand prize raffle and entertainment. St. Boniface Catholic Church, 629 2nd St. NE, will hold its twenty-seventh annual German Dinner and Polka Mass on Sunday, Oct. 9, 11 a.m.-2 p.m. following a 10 a.m. Polka Mass with Rod Cerar's band who will also perform for dinner dancing. Tickets for the dinner are $12/adults, $5/children 12 and under. Take-out is available. The authentic German menu includes: Jaegerschnitzel (roast pork), potato dumplings, sauerkraut, red cabbage, and beehive pastry. There will also be a silent auction. Handicap accessible.…
